This traditional bock beer named Fekete is defined by the taste of malts: besides the roasted Münich malt, caramel and adjunct malts add a sweet, roasted flavour. To make the picture a whole, Hallertau hop assures appropriate spiciness, resulting in a strong, full-body beer. The this type first brewed in the mercantile city of Einbeck and later revived by Bavarian brewers named after the city as ein bock. Different versions of bocks are common, Fekete is a traditional dunkelbock.

Medium brown head. Nearly opaque black body goes barely translucent deep dark brown at edges. Earthy oily roughly herbal aroma with licorice and soy sauce notes. Dry-sweet roasty chocolate and licorice taste with roasty herbal notes. Mid-to-full body. Mild, mealy mouthfeel. Dryish rough roasty chocolatey aftertaste with earthy burnt mineraly notes. A bit like a steinbier. Drinkable and different. Interesting, harmonic, and well balanced. (0.5l bottle, from Kezmuves Csemege, Budapest.)
